We're looking at buying our first travel trailer, and we're considering a 2016 Jay Flight 28RBDS. It has the island in the middle with opposing slides, and the slide in the kitchen carries the refrigerator and stove. When we went to look at it, I noticed that when it's fully retracted, the kitchen slide sticks out slightly further at the bottom than at the top. The seal is making contact all the way around, but it is definitely not completely flush. The more I've looked into these, the more I see that being the case on these kitchen slides. Every single one I've found appears to be the same. It has to be a lot of weight on that slide, so is this normal, or is this a known defect with the kitchen slides? Do you know if these tend to have problems with leaking?
